  DICK CAREY'S TALK.

Dick's Talk was supposed to be in January, but due to the weather it had to be postponed until July, the crowded church was the evidence of that it was well worth the wait!  There is no doubt whatsoever that our village would not be the place it is without the many, many decades of enthusiasm and work that Dick has, quietly behind the scenes, tirelessly put into it.  It is thanks to him that we enjoy so many of the facilities that we have now, enjoyed the many events that we have in the past, and, of course, look forward to the events that we will enjoy in the future.  

Dick's enthusiasm and many talents mean that he, among things, was behind or the instigator of: the Football Clubs, the Bonfire Nights, Village Hall events, teaching Carriage Driving to young people, improving the Village Facilities as Chairman of the Parish Council, using his carpentry skills as a Wheelwright to make items and donate any profit to Hooe Church, being a friend of HRH. Prince Philip, teaching young people how to look after horses and ponies, and so the list went on and on!
